How to prepare for a job interview at IP-People
✨Know Your Cyber Security Stuff
Make sure you brush up on the latest trends and technologies in cyber security, especially around vendors like Juniper and Fortinet. Being able to discuss these topics confidently will show that you're not just familiar with the industry but are genuinely passionate about it.
✨Showcase Your Sales Skills
Prepare specific examples of how you've successfully acquired new business in the past.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, making it easy for the interviewer to see your impact and approach to sales.
✨Communicate Clearly and Confidently
Strong communication skills are key for this role.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. Consider doing mock interviews with a friend or using video tools to refine your delivery and body language.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s growth plans, team dynamics, and how they measure success in the role.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
